Another note why FASA doesn't publish (most of) the history before the real
"now": you can read this in numerous other books. While games like Vampire
like to show you "what really happened and what the influence of the
vampires was", in Shadowrun the history until "real now" in the game is the
same as in the real world. It is the "history" between "real now" and
"game
now" that they like to detail, and by leaving out the "old stuff", they
have more space for it!
